Translation — Tafsir
Word Meanings:
- Yaghfir lakum min dhunūbikum – "He will forgive you your sins": The word *min* here indicates a part, meaning He will forgive the sins that pertain to His rights, while those involving the rights of other people require restitution.
- Yu'akhkhirkum – "And will delay you": He will prolong your lives and spare you from punishment.
- Ajalin musammā – "To an appointed term": A fixed time known only to Allah, which is the moment of your death.
- Ajalu Allah – "The term of Allah": The time decreed for your destruction or death.
Explanation of the Verse:
In this blessed verse, Prophet Nūḥ (peace be upon him) continues his sincere call to his people, inviting them to faith and obedience. He tells them: If you respond to my call—believing in Allah alone, fearing His punishment, and obeying His commands—then Allah will forgive you your sins and wash away your misdeeds. Moreover, He will grant you a blessed extension in your lives, keeping you safe from the torment that would otherwise seize you, until the appointed time of your natural death. This is a profound mercy: that repentance and faith do not only secure the Hereafter, but also bring blessings and longevity in this world.
Then Nūḥ warns them with a profound truth: when Allah's decree arrives—whether it is the moment of death or the punishment for persistent disbelief—it cannot be delayed or pushed back even for an instant. If only they truly knew this reality, they would hasten to faith and repentance before the door of opportunity closes. The verse is a gentle yet firm reminder that time is precious, and every moment of delay in turning to Allah is a loss that cannot be recovered.
A Call to Reflection and Action:
Dear reader, this verse carries a timeless message for every soul. It teaches us that the path to Allah is not one of hardship and deprivation, but of mercy, forgiveness, and abundant blessings. When you turn to your Lord in sincerity, He does not merely erase your sins—He opens doors of provision, peace, and longevity that you never imagined. The Prophet ﷺ said: "Whoever loves that his provision be expanded and his life be extended, let him maintain ties of kinship" (agreed upon). And what greater tie than the bond with your Creator through faith and obedience?
Yet, the verse also awakens us from the slumber of procrastination. We often say, "I will repent later," or "I will pray when I am older," forgetting that the appointed term is unknown. The Messenger of Allah ﷺ said: "Take advantage of five before five: your youth before your old age, your health before your sickness, your wealth before your poverty, your free time before your preoccupation, and your life before your death" (al-Ḥākim).
